| Game Type | Average Return to Player (RTP) |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(Classic) | 99.09% |
| Roulette (European) | 97.30% |
| Baccarat | 98.94% |
| Online Slots | 96.00% (varies greatly) |
The RTP, or Return to Player, percentage indicates the theoretical amount a game will pay back to players over time. Understanding these percentages can assist in choosing games that offer better odds. It’s important to remember that RTP is a theoretical calculation and does not guarantee individual results.
Responsible Gaming and Player Safety
Prioritizing responsible gaming is paramount in the online casino industry. Reputable operators offer a range of t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support organizations. Players should always set a budget before playing and stick to it, avoiding chasing losses.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time and money than intended, or experiencing negative consequences as a result of gambling, is crucial for seeking help. A proactive approach to responsible gaming is essential for ensuring a safe and enjoyable experience.
Player safety is also a critical concern, and reputable online casinos employ robust security measures to protect their customers' personal and financial information. These measures include encryption technology, firewalls, and regular security audits. Licensing and regulation by reputable authorities, such as the UK Gambling Commission, provide an additional layer of protection, ensuring that the casino operates fairly and transparently. Players should always verify that a casino is licensed and regulated before depositing any funds. Choosing a secure and trustworthy platform is vital for peace of mind.

Understanding Licensing and Regulation
Licensing and regulation are vital components of a safe and trustworthy online casino environment. Licensing authorities, such as the UK Gambling Commission and the Malta Gaming Authority, impose strict requirements on operators, including financial stability, security measures, and responsible gaming practices. They also conduct regular audits to ensure that casinos are complying with these requirements. A valid license is a clear indication that a casino has met certain standards of quality and integrity. Players should always verify that a casino holds a valid license from a reputable authority before depositing any funds.
Furthermore, licensed casinos are subject to dispute resolution mechanisms, providing players with a means of recourse in the event of a disagreement. These mechanisms typically involve independent arbitration or mediation services. The availability of effective dispute resolution processes adds an extra layer of protection for players, ensuring that their concerns are addressed fairly and impartially. Choosing a licensed casino is, therefore, a crucial step in safeguarding your interests.
